Comprehending Front Doors with Windows
Front doors with windows can be found in different styles and products, offering an exceptional mix of aesthetics and usefulness. These doors normally feature glass panels that can be designed in various sizes, shapes, and designs, allowing natural light to light up the entryway while offering a clear view of the exterior.
Advantages of Front Doors with Windows
Choosing a front door with a window provides several benefits:
Natural Light: The primary advantage is the increase of natural light. This can make the entryway brilliant and inviting.Visibility: Windows in front doors often supply exposure to the outdoors world, boosting awareness of visitors before unlocking.Visual Appeal: A front door with a window can serve as a declaration piece, add character to your home, and enhance the general architectural design.Airflow: Some designs permit ventilation, enhancing airflow in the entrance.Security Features: Modern front doors with windows typically include tempered glass or other security features to discourage burglaries.Popular Designs and Styles

When thinking about a front door with a window, the material is crucial for toughness, insulation, and upkeep. Here are some typically used materials:
1. FiberglassHighly suggested due to energy efficiency.Resistant to warping and can simulate the appearance of wood.Low upkeep requirements.2. WoodDeals traditional appeal and heat.Requires regular upkeep (staining or painting) to avoid weather condition damage.Various kinds of wood can offer special looks.3. SteelProvides high security and sturdiness.More resistant to effect than wood or fiberglass.Restricted style versatility however can be tailored.4.
